THE ROLE As Account Director, the main objective is to profitably grow overall client investment, to ensure the success of both clients and agency. The Director is responsible for the account management team’s success, consistency, and efficiency in delivering strategies and services that meet client performance goals and grow billings. The Director will be expected to lead by example in collaborating positively with other team leaders and departments to exceed client goals. These other departments include: finance, media, creative, executive, business development, and administrative.

Essential Duties include but are not limited to: Understand customer’s strategy, key decision makers, competitors and business model, including Oxford Road’s position in their business and how they quantify our value, with the goal of building interdependence with the client. Continually communicate up-to-date client strategy effectively and completely to internal teams so they can provide the best possible service to our clients. Including: media, creative, finance and analytics teams. Provide accurate and timely reports to leadership, e.g.: forecasts, opportunities, threats, market intelligence, etc Lead the development and strategic vision for Quarterly Business Reviews, leading the presentations and assigning roles to colleagues. Client-facing materials )e.g. Presentations, proposals, communications) must meet the high standards that our clients expect, that set Oxford Road apart from the competition. Devise (with Media Dept) & pitch new schedules to grow clients’ business & their media investment and deliver ongoing plan optimizations to improve performance and exceed goals Use performance insights to direct and pitch new solutions that fit the clients’ business goals. Train, mentor, manage, guide, and retain team talent in the model of Servant Leadership Act as the primary point of contact for client escalations Demonstrate an exemplary attitude of collaboration across teams: e.g. creative, media, finance, analytics, etc. Delight clients and form strong relationships founded on professional and personal excellence
